by Bob Suter of Newsday: The new year brings a new calendar sprinkled with special events - anniversaries, weddings, birthdays, bar mitzvahs, etc. It also brings a new site that aims to eliminate much of the legwork involved in assembling the elements needed for a special occasion. Utilizing the MyAffair.com search screen, you fill in the ZIP code, date and time of your event. Then, from a series of pulldown menus, you indicate the event, service you require (band, bartender, hall rental, photographer, etc.) and amount you'd like to spend. The site searches its database of entries and returns a list of those in your geographic area most closely meeting your criteria. Listings include pricing and contact information and are often accompanied by a photo. A trial query seeking a band to perform at a wedding produced musical options including a salsa band, a harpist and a duo playing classical and jazz/contemporary music, the latter offering MP3 samples of their performances. Those providing services can list with the site free of charge.
